US sprinter Sha’Carri Richardson eased through from the women’s 100 metres heats on Thursday, while Jakob Ingebrigtsen conserved energy in the 1,500m and Ukraine’s biggest gold medal hope Yaroslava Mahuchikh qualified first in the women’s high jump. World champion Richardson, whose chances of Paris gold have been boosted by Rio and Tokyo champion Elaine Thompson-Herah missing out through injury, ran the quickest time in her heat of 10.94 seconds ahead of Saturday’s semi-finals and final.
